Lot Leveling in Salt Lake City, UT
Lot leveling services involve adjusting the elevation of a property’s land surface to create a stable, even foundation. This process is commonly requested for projects such as preparing a yard for construction, improving drainage, or ensuring proper grading around a home’s foundation. Property owners typically want to understand how the work can help prevent issues like water pooling or uneven ground, which can impact landscaping, outdoor usability, and the longevity of structures. It’s important to consider the current slope and condition of the land, as well as any local regulations or permits that may be required before proceeding with leveling projects.
Before requesting lot leveling services, property owners should evaluate the scope of the project, including the size of the area and the degree of unevenness. Clarifying the desired outcome-such as a flat yard or specific grading slopes-can help determine the most suitable approach. Additionally, understanding the existing soil conditions and potential challenges, like underground utilities or drainage systems, ensures that the work will meet expectations. Proper assessment and planning can contribute to a successful project that enhances the safety and functionality of the property.

Lot Leveling Questions
What is lot leveling? Lot leveling involves adjusting the terrain to create a flat, stable surface for construction or landscaping projects.
Why is lot leveling important? Proper lot leveling prevents water pooling, reduces erosion, and provides a solid foundation for building structures.
What types of properties benefit from lot leveling? Residential yards, commercial sites, and land prepared for new construction often require lot leveling services.
How does lot leveling impact property value? Leveling can enhance the usability and appearance of a property, potentially increasing its value and appeal.
